Popular Welding Certifications
Although the American Welding Society’s normal Certified Welder certificate opens the door for almost all job opportunities, certain fields will require their certain certificate. Examples of the most-popular of which appear below.
- API Certification for individuals that work on pipelines in the energy industry
- ASME Certification for those that deal with boiler and pressurized vessels
- Certified Welding Instructor and Senior Certified Welding Instructor Certifications for inspectors and senior inspectors
- CW Certificates to be a Certified Welder

Career and Salary
What is the Career Forecast for Welding Specialists in Choudrant, LA?
O*Net Online forecasts that the demand for welders in Louisiana will approach all-time levels within the next several years. The increase in new work opportunities for welders are predicted to go up across the country by the year 2022 and in Louisiana. In summary, if you are contemplating becoming a welder, your time simply couldn’t be any better.
This data features wages and employment estimates for professional welders in the State of Louisiana through the end of the decade.
| Louisiana | Employment |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 2022 | Change | Annual Job Openings |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ers | 14,590 | 16,640 | 14% | 650 |
| Louisiana | Annual Salary |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| Median | High |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ers |
$29,800 | $42,000 | $59,200 |
Source: O*Net Online
